Output 6288d9be60a41cd01335d7bf5395d3ba2b58959f0db419e74083d2cd043fb94a:3

value
150339227
script pubkey
OP_0 OP_PUSHBYTES_20 5dce987e26e667d70c58afd881747351d6de96ac
address
ltc1qth8fsl3xuenawrzc4lvgzarn28tda94v8p2vds
transaction
6288d9be60a41cd01335d7bf5395d3ba2b58959f0db419e74083d2cd043fb94a
spent
true